jze9 65d8b633ad Wire up reporting (plots, BOM, summary, animation) and a working CLI (Stage 7)
- report/plots.py: current/field/velocity plots per stage, Agg backend so
  it works headless in Docker/on a server
- report/bom.py: itemized bill of materials with real component prices
- report/summary.py: honest text/JSON summary including a
  "model limitations" section and a saturation warning flag per stage
- report/animate.py: the visualization the user explicitly asked for --
  a GIF of the slug flying through the tube with each coil glowing by its
  instantaneous current, reconstructing the pre-trigger ballistic flight
  segment (not just the stored discharge phase) for a continuous timeline
- cli.py: sweep/evolve/simulate/report subcommands now actually call the
  underlying modules instead of being stubs
- Extended StageResult/StageOutcome with the coil/entry-state fields the
  report layer needed (mu_eff, turns, coil_length, entry_x/v) rather than
  recomputing them by other means

Verified end-to-end through `docker compose run`, not just pytest: a real
sweep (30 runs, 11 feasible) followed by `report --animate` produced a
correct GIF/plots/BOM/summary for the actual best result found (32.8%
efficiency, 982 RUB) -- not a synthetic fixture.

Симулятор и оптимизатор многоступенчатого электромагнитного ускорителя (coilgun) на реальных, доступных в рознице компонентах.

Полный план и чек-лист этапов — в PLAN.md.

Установка (Docker — основной способ)

docker compose build
docker compose run --rm --entrypoint pytest gausse -q   # тесты
docker compose run --rm gausse sweep --n 1000            # CLI (после реализации Этапа 6)

Результаты (SQLite, отчёты) должны сохраняться в ./results, примонтированный в контейнер как /app/results (см. docker-compose.yml), чтобы переживать пересборку образа.

Установка без Docker (локальная разработка)

python3 -m venv .venv
source .venv/bin/activate
pip install -e ".[dev]"
pytest
